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
An Outline of Metal Finishing - Mostly, metal polishing is desirable for a pleasing appearance as well as clean-room application. It's one of the more preferred techniques because of its utility in increasing the overall beauty of the item, such as, auto parts, kitchenware or motorbike parts. Moreover, a great many clean-rooms call for a lustrous finish so to minimize the penetrability of the material that may result in particles to collect and contaminate. An outstanding instance of this use might be in vacuum chambers. There are countless strategies to polish metal, and let's have a review of several of the techniques required. Metal may be finished manually by hand, with purpose built buffing machines, electromechanically or utilizing chemicals. A polishing paste or compound is regularly utilized, which can consist of dolomite, limestone, tripoli, aluminum oxide, chromium oxide, chalk,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, because of its lousy thermal conductivity, relatively high viscidness, and hardness is among the most time-consuming. On the other hand, items created from non-ferrous metal are certainly more responsive to buffing, as they need the minimum number of treatments.
If a superior processing quality is simply not required, faster pad speeds can be employed. A decreased pad speed is commonly used whenever a superior mirror finish is expected. Polishing buffs coated in paste are appreciably impacted by the pressures on the finishing pad. The concentration of the surface pressure could be raised within certain limitations, though going beyond the maximum degree of pressure not simply lowers the quality level of treatment, but in addition degrades effectiveness, might cause wear to the part, and there's additionally an evident heating up of the metal being worked on, on account of friction. When working thinner material, it is raised heat (and a relating flexibility of the metal) that will quite possibly cause components to bend, flex or warp. Typically, it will take a knowledgeable polisher to take into consideration each one of these elements to equally prevent damage to the workpiece and to perform the job effectively. In order to substantially enhance the quality of the completed surface, the finishing process has to be executed with significantly less power and not so much force so as to in the end complete a surface devoid of scratches or marks coming from the finishing procedure, subsequently ending up with a fabulous mirror finish.
